Navigate work spaces

Procedure
Swipe left or right on an open space on the home screen to go to the work space to the left or to the right.

Widgets

Widgets are small applications that you can place on the home screen. Widgets provide at-a-glance information
and some functions from full applications.
The following table describes some of the widgets that your phone includes:

Set up home screen

Add applications, widgets, and folders, or change your wallpaper to set up your home screen.
